Address Element Tutorial
<address>
Introductory Text
The address element represents contact information for a document when applied to the body element or a section of a document. An address may be an a href or it may be a postal address.
- Start tag:
<address>- End tag:
</address>
Use Examples
- Example [Basic (HTML 4)]:
-
The address of the person responsible for vagaries of this Example would be:
Mr. Cale, contact person for the Academy in Peril
$Date: 1919/12/25 23:37:50 Paris$ - Code [HTML]:
-
<p>The address of the person responsible for vagaries of this Example would be:</p> <address> <a href="http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/John_Cale">Mr. Cale</a>, contact person for the <a href="Academy">Academy in Peril</a><br> $Date: 1919/12/25 23:37:50 Paris$ </address>
- Example [Basic (HTML 5)]:
-
The address of the person or persons purporting final responsibility for this Example may be:
Menehune Foundry — 13, Sungai Sarawak, Borneo. - Code [HTML]:
-
<p>The address of the person or persons purporting final responsibility for this Example may be:</p> <address> Menehune Foundry — 13, Sungai Sarawak, Borneo. </address>
